Most hunters are used to turkeys avoiding them altogether, but maybe that’s because a Weatherby shotgun is more intimidating than a garden hose. Web28 mrt. 2024 · Yes, wild turkeys eat snakes. To be honest, wild turkeys will eat just about anything they get their hands on, or to be more accurate, their beaks. Wild turkeys kill and eat all kinds of snakes. Many have seen them eating rattle snakes, garter snakes and blacksnakes. Just about any snake they can successfully kill.

Web16 apr. 2024 · Shelter. Turkeys roost overnight up in large, mature trees, so having deciduous trees in a thick patch—or leaving a woodland border intact adjacent to the yard—will help provide their desired shelter.
